EBIT, sometimes also called Earnings Before Interest and Taxes, is a measure of a firm's profit that includes all expenses except interest and income tax expenses. It is the difference between operating revenues and operating expenses. When a firm does not have non-operating income, then Operating Income is sometimes used as a synonym for EBIT and operating profit.

PT Bintang Mitra Semestaraya Tbk Business Description

Address Jalan Jenderal Gatot Subroto Kav 23, Graha BIP Building, 2nd Floor, South Jakarta, Jakarta, IDN, 12930
PT Bintang Mitra Semestaraya Tbk is an investment holding company. The company's operating segment includes Chemical Goods and Coal trading segment. It generates the majority of its revenue from Chemical Goods. The company markets chemical products which include Caustic Soda both in liquid and flake, Hydrochloric Acid, Sodium Hypochlorite, Sulfuric Acid, PVC resin and Ethylene Dichloride.
